Job Description

At Smiths Detection, we develop and deliver cutting-edge threat detection and screening technologies that help make the world a safer place. Our solutions are trusted by governments, defence organisations, critical infrastructure operators, ports, borders and transportation networks around the globe.

We are seeking an experienced Global Service Contracts & Programmes Manager to join our Global Services Commercial & Strategic Programmes team. This is a highly visible role responsible for managing complex service contracts and programmes supporting key defence customers, including the UK Ministry of Defence (MoD).

This position offers an excellent opportunity to influence commercial performance, drive customer satisfaction, and lead strategic service programmes within a global business.

The Role

As the Global Service Contracts & Programmes Manager, you will take ownership of a portfolio of high-value service contracts and programmes, acting as the primary customer interface while coordinating activities across commercial, service, sales, finance and operational teams.

You will ensure contracts are delivered successfully, commercially optimised, and positioned for future growth. Working closely with defence customers and internal stakeholders, you will drive performance, manage risk, oversee financial commitments, and identify opportunities to enhance customer value and expand business relationships.

What You Will Be Doing

  • Lead the commercial and financial management of assigned service contracts and programmes.
  • Manage contract revenue, forecasting, budgeting, cost control and profitability.
  • Establish and monitor KPIs relating to revenue, margin, delivery performance and customer satisfaction.
  • Produce and maintain programme schedules covering maintenance activities, upgrades, engineering changes, repairs, installations and asset movements.
  • Ensure contractual obligations are delivered on time, within budget and in line with customer expectations.
  • Act as the primary customer contact for assigned contracts and programmes.
  • Conduct regular customer review meetings and drive actions through to completion.
  • Manage contract risks, mitigation plans and escalation processes.
  • Support contract amendments, renewals, negotiations and approvals.
  • Develop business cases and proposals for incremental growth opportunities.
  • Collaborate with internal teams to drive continuous improvement, efficiency and cost reduction initiatives.
  • Maintain audit-ready financial records in accordance with UK MoD requirements.
  • Manage subcontractor performance and ensure contractual flow-down obligations are met.
  • Contribute to strategic customer account planning, forecasting and demand planning activities.

About You

You are a commercially minded programme or contract management professional with experience delivering complex service-based contracts in a defence environment.

You thrive in customer-facing roles, enjoy solving complex challenges and have a proven track record of driving commercial and operational performance.

Essential Experience

  • Commercial management of UK MoD contracts.
  • Service delivery, contract management and programme management experience.
  • Management of significant multi-million-pound service contracts.
  • Experience within defence, maintenance, repair and overhaul (MRO) or related technical service environments.
  • Financial management, cost control and profit improvement.
  • Drafting business proposals, contract amendments and commercial documentation.

Essential Knowledge & Skills

  • Strong commercial and financial acumen.
  • Understanding of UK MoD contracting practices and Single Source Regulations.
  • Programme and project management expertise.
  • Risk management and change management experience.
  • Planning and schedule management capability.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to influence stakeholders across multiple functions and locations.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's Degree or equivalent experience.
  • Programme Management qualification desirable.

Security Requirements

Due to the nature of the programmes supported by this role, applicants must be eligible to obtain and maintain UK Security Clearance.
